Course structure

• Introduction to Disability Awareness in Mental Health
• Advanced Strategies for Inclusive Mental Health Practices
• Trauma-Informed Care Techniques for Individuals with Disabilities
• Ethical Considerations in Disability-Informed Mental Health Services
• Intersectionality and Mental Health: Addressing Diverse Needs
• Communication Skills for Engaging Clients with Disabilities
• Disability Rights and Advocacy in Mental Health Settings
• Assistive Technologies and Tools for Mental Health Professionals
• Crisis Intervention for Individuals with Disabilities
• Building Disability-Inclusive Mental Health Programs and Policies

The Advanced Certificate in Disability Awareness is increasingly vital for mental health professionals in today’s market, as the demand for inclusive and accessible mental health services grows. In the UK, 1 in 4 people experience a mental health problem each year, and many of these individuals also face disabilities. Mental health professionals equipped with disability awareness skills are better positioned to provide holistic care, ensuring that services are tailored to diverse needs. This certification not only enhances empathy and understanding but also aligns with the UK’s Equality Act 2010, which mandates reasonable adjustments for disabled individuals.
